Agrodolce Bianco
Agrodolce Bianco is an Italian sweet and sour dressing made from white grape must of the Trebbiano grape and white wine vinegar. The name describes the principle directly: agro for sour, dolce for sweet — the interplay results in a mild, fruity balance that is significantly less sharp than pure vinegar.
The grape must brings bright fruitiness and natural sweetness, while the white wine vinegar adds a refreshing acidity. The result is well-rounded and approachable. In the kitchen, Agrodolce Bianco is ideal as a base for vinaigrettes, marinades, or light sauces. It pairs well with grilled poultry, Caprese salad, or steamed fish—and as a dressing component, it harmonizes beautifully with dry white wines such as Verdicchio or Soave.
